Output e3526de24b42797e9ac15a6c12fa71eb0a54927c76722a648d43db249881bcae:1

value
251584207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91730ccf212df82970d640f6f2b8bc4593217f16 OP_EQUAL
address
3Ex5jB9ZZcjZFDdzer7v81NMFRMVas8q9w
transaction
e3526de24b42797e9ac15a6c12fa71eb0a54927c76722a648d43db249881bcae
spent
true